macOS Simulator 部署目标设置为 13.5,但此平台支持的部署目标版本范围为 13.1 到 13.4.999

Posted

技术标签:

【中文标题】macOS Simulator 部署目标设置为 13.5,但此平台支持的部署目标版本范围为 13.1 到 13.4.999【英文标题】:macOS Simulator deployment target set to 13.5, but the range of supported deployment target version for this platform is from 13.1 to 13.4.999 【发布时间】:2020-10-16 11:25:25 【问题描述】:

我在 Xcode 版本 11.5 (11E608c) 中收到此警告消息

Mac Catalyst 部署目标“IPHONEOS_DEPLOYMENT_TARGET”设置为 13.5,但支持的部署目标版本范围是 13.1 到 13.4.99。 (在“食物追踪器”项目的目标“食物追踪器”中)

the warning

我的部署目标是通用二进制文件

my deployment target

我做错了什么?

【问题讨论】:

***.com/questions/62118264/mac-catalyst-and-ios-13-5 的副本。真的没有必要重复它。如果它在那里得到解决,那么根据定义,它在任何地方都得到解决。 嗨@matt。不,我没有使用任何豆荚可可或其他,只是普通的旧 Xcode @matt 哦,我明白了。抱歉重复的问题......当我写它时,它没有出现在自动填充部分。我将按照该线程进行任何更新。谢谢! 【参考方案1】:

你没有做错任何事。只需在 Build Settings 中降低 iOS 部署目标即可降低 Mac Catalyst 部署目标。 显然您在目标的 Deployment Info 中选择了“Mac”,并且当前 Xcode 版本不支持 Mac Catalyst 部署目标 13.5。

【讨论】:

以上是关于macOS Simulator 部署目标设置为 13.5,但此平台支持的部署目标版本范围为 13.1 到 13.4.999的主要内容,如果未能解决你的问题,请参考以下文章

支持的部署目标版本范围是 9.0 到 14.55 Error While Running Flutter App on iOS Simulator

重新启用 iPhone Simulator 定位服务

为`swift package generate-xcodeproj`设置macOS目标?

iOS:处理 TARGET_IPHONE_SIMULATOR 宏

为`swift package generate-xcodeproj`设置macOS目标?

Xcode 12 Beta 2 - 无法为目标“arm64-apple-ios14.0-simulator”加载标准库